Output 73868a505ef74f1cb74e53eb8e1235c936f25952c55986fea66e5981f2a21cb9:0

value
18516740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f775419fadf8759e8c36bf536fd800914b91af OP_EQUAL
address
39XZoXyZ5XpnZQUzk2T9jwFfXeXgqrcB9A
transaction
73868a505ef74f1cb74e53eb8e1235c936f25952c55986fea66e5981f2a21cb9
spent
true